Yesterday I attended the Georges Hobeika Fall 2011 collection.
With a steadily growing celebrity fan base, I was very excited to view what we should expect to see on the red carpet in the coming months.
The designer was inspired by the timeless feminine grace of Greek goddess Antheia.
She was the goddess of flowers and flowery wreaths worn at festivals and parties. This translated onto the runway via beautiful blossoms and the free flowing silhouettes.
Mushroom pleats and romantic lace accented layers of fine organza, crepe and georgette on a refreshing colour palette of moon grey, lilac and shades of bubblegum pinks.
Subtle embellishments dazzled on the runway, ruched backs accented the derrière, whilst satin ribbons provided the perfect finishing touch to many looks.

One look I would be interested to see how it translates onto the red carpet was a long sleeved white crepe dress which had a sexy lace back with a satin bow accent.
Favourites: Pink sleeveless gown with swirling detail and fine embellishments and the pink one-shoulder vase gown
Shoes Georges Hobeika embellished pointy pumps

The finale gown was breath-taking. The mermaid ivory gown had a white overlay which fell from a beautiful embellished wreath at the waist.
